- Effect of oxidation state on M–C bond
In metal carbonyls, bonding has two components:
- donation from to metal
- back-bonding from filled metal orbitals to empty orbitals of
If oxidation state of the metal is lower, the metal is more electron-rich, so it can do more back-bonding. More back-bonding strengthens the metal–carbon bond.
Hence option C is correct.
- Effect on C–O bond
More back-bonding puts electron density into antibonding orbital of , which weakens the bond.
Now if oxidation state of metal is increased, the metal becomes less electron-rich, so back-bonding decreases. Then the bond should become stronger, not weaker.
Therefore option D is false.
